Transaction 38fcebac0829d738205c221252c71d54d86bf98ecb5e3d2693c383f1452b9144
1 Input
1 Output
-
38fcebac0829d738205c221252c71d54d86bf98ecb5e3d2693c383f1452b9144:0
- value
- 1519791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37629a48339c85fa5ea835e4f042d59950d9f OP_EQUAL
- address
- 3BMEXh88b8SEHDJnfFiLfvmbjxdikBuG2J